Transaction 21e64f6d262c21b649af4f05948244ebc53371acbb0e468e22cb53996474e906

1 Input
2 Outputs
  • 21e64f6d262c21b649af4f05948244ebc53371acbb0e468e22cb53996474e906:0
  • value  2377618
    address  1PzriXuBRVShZncHCEo1adaHXu7UoF9iER
  • 21e64f6d262c21b649af4f05948244ebc53371acbb0e468e22cb53996474e906:1
  • value  17443
    address  bc1qpv9jqdlvnwy7axrp6950rvkxxmw95yvssdp5dg